Give reasons for accepting the constitution which was made by the Constitution Assembly more than 50 years ago?

The reasons for acceptability of the constitution until today are as follows:

A. The constitution does not reflect the views of its members alone. It expresses a broad consensus of its time.


B. The Constituent Assembly represented the people of India. Since there was no universal adult franchise at that time, the Constituent Assembly could not have been chosen directly by the people. It was elected, mainly by the members of Provincial Legislatures, which ensured a fair share of all the regions of the country.


C. The Constituent Assembly worked in a systematic, open and consensual manner. The nature of work done by the Constituent Assembly gave sanctity to the constitution.
